where to purchase xanax online xanax epocrates online can i buy xanax over the counter in spain what is the best online pharmacy for xanax xanax 2mg for sale online doctors who write prescriptions for xanax where to purchase xanax online xanax epocrates online can i buy xanax over the counter in spain what is the best online pharmacy for xanax xanax 2mg for sale online doctors who write prescriptions for xanax where to purchase xanax online xanax epocrates online can i buy xanax over the counter in spain what is the best online pharmacy for xanax xanax 2mg for sale online doctors who write prescriptions for xanax where to purchase xanax online xanax epocrates online can i buy xanax over the counter in spain what is the best online pharmacy for xanax xanax 2mg for sale online doctors who write prescriptions for xanax